Bayesian Programming

4.3

بر اساس نظر کاربران

شما میتونید سوالاتتون در باره کتاب رو از هوش مصنوعیش بعد از ورود بپرسید
هر دانلود یا پرسش از هوش مصنوعی 2 امتیاز لازم دارد، برای بدست آوردن امتیاز رایگان، به صفحه ی راهنمای امتیازات سر بزنید و یک سری کار ارزشمند انجام بدین

معرفی کتاب "Bayesian Programming"

کتاب Bayesian Programming یکی از مهم‌ترین و تأثیرگذارترین آثار در حوزه پردازش اطلاعات، تحلیل داده‌ها و طراحی سیستم‌های تصمیم‌گیری است. این کتاب که توسط نویسندگان برجسته‌ای چون "Pierre Bessiere"، "Emmanuel Mazer"، "Juan Manuel Ahuactzin" و "Kamel Mekhnacha" نوشته شده است، رویکردی جامع و عملی به برنامه‌نویسی احتمالاتی ارائه می‌دهد. هدف اصلی این کتاب، فراهم کردن چارچوبی است که خوانندگان را قادر سازد تا از Bayesian Programming برای مدل‌سازی و شبیه‌سازی سیستم‌های پیچیده استفاده کنند.

خلاصه کامل کتاب

Bayesian Programming یک چارچوب نظری و عملی برای مدل‌سازی رفتارهای پیچیده سیستم‌ها با استفاده از احتمالات ارائه می‌دهد. این کتاب از پایه‌های اساسی نظریه احتمالات شروع کرده و مفاهیمی چون Bayesian Inference، مدل‌های گرافیکی و روش‌های تخمین پارامتر را به زبانی ساده ولی دقیق توضیح می‌دهد.

علاوه بر مبانی نظری، این کتاب مثال‌های عملی زیادی دارد که به خوانندگان کمک می‌کند تا نه تنها مفاهیم کتاب را بهتر درک کنند، بلکه مهارت‌های لازم برای پیاده‌سازی مدل‌ها در پروژه‌های واقعی را نیز بیاموزند. از تحلیل داده‌های تجربی گرفته تا ساخت ربات‌های تصمیم‌گیرنده هوشمند، این کتاب نمونه‌های بسیاری از کاربردهای Bayesian Approach در حوزه‌های مختلف ارائه کرده است.

در نهایت، این کتاب عنوان می‌کند که Bayesian Programming راهکاری نیست که صرفاً برای اهداف آماری مناسب باشد، بلکه چارچوبی جامع است که در حوزه‌های مختلف از علم داده، هوش مصنوعی، تا علوم رفتاری و مهندسی کاربرد دارد.

نکات کلیدی کتاب

  • تعریف و ساختار Bayesian Programming به همراه اصول اساسی آن.
  • استفاده از روش‌های Bayesian برای تصمیم‌گیری در شرایط عدم قطعیت.
  • آموزش طراحی و پیاده‌سازی سیستم‌های تصمیم‌گیری مبتنی بر داده.
  • کاوش در قابلیت‌های مدل‌های گرافیکی و Bayesian Inference.
  • توسعه سیستم‌های تطبیق‌پذیر که توانایی یادگیری از داده‌ها را دارند.
  • توضیح راهکارهای عملی برای شبیه‌سازی سیستم‌های پیچیده در پروژه‌های واقعی.

جملات مشهور از کتاب

"Bayesian Programming is not just a statistical tool; it is a universal language for understanding and modeling complexity."

“Uncertainty is not a limitation; it's a feature that can be leveraged for better decision-making.”

“By combining probability theory with algorithms, we can create systems that perceive, learn, and act intelligently.”

چرا این کتاب مهم است؟

در دنیای امروز که داده‌ها و اطلاعات در هر زمینه‌ای به سرعت در حال رشد هستند، یکی از چالش‌های بزرگ نحوه مدیریت و تحلیل این داده‌هاست. Bayesian Programming نه تنها تکنیک‌های عملی ارائه می‌دهد، بلکه طرز تفکری نوین را که مبتنی بر روابط احتمالاتی است، تقویت می‌کند.

از این رو، این کتاب برای دانشجویان، پژوهشگران و مهندسانی که علاقه‌مند به یادگیری عمیق‌تر روش‌های تحلیل داده، یادگیری ماشین و سیستم‌های هوشمند هستند، ضروری است. همچنین، این کتاب به دلیل ارائه چارچوبی عمومی برای مدل‌سازی در شرایط عدم قطعیت، در پروژه‌های کاربردی و تحقیقاتی بسیار مورد استفاده قرار می‌گیرد.

همچنین، رویکرد نویسندگان در ارائه مطالب طوری است که مطالب برای خوانندگان با زمینه‌های مختلف علمی قابل فهم و کاربردی باشد. به همین دلیل، این کتاب جایگاه برجسته‌ای در بین منابع مورد استفاده در حوزه هوش مصنوعی و تحلیل داده‌ها دارد.

Introduction to "Bayesian Programming"

Bayesian Programming explores the fascinating intersection of probability theory, artificial intelligence, and cognitive science, offering readers an innovative framework for decision-making in uncertain environments. Written by Pierre Bessiere, Emmanuel Mazer, Juan Manuel Ahuactzin, and Kamel Mekhnacha, this book serves as both a theoretical foundation and practical guide for anyone seeking to harness the power of Bayesian inference. With a unique approach that balances rigorous scientific concepts with accessibility, "Bayesian Programming" is an essential guide for academics, professionals, and enthusiasts of machine learning, robotics, and applied statistics.

The book introduces new ways to solve complex problems by utilizing probabilistic reasoning. Designed to be comprehensive yet approachable, it offers a step-by-step guide to implementing computational models based on Bayesian principles. Emphasis is placed on real-world applications, including robotics, medical diagnostics, natural language processing, and more. If you're looking to deepen your understanding of uncertain systems and probabilistic models, this book is your ultimate reference.

What is Bayesian Programming? A Detailed Summary

At its heart, Bayesian Programming is a methodology pioneered to model and solve problems characterized by uncertainty. Bayesian reasoning allows systems to make decisions based on incomplete or ambiguous data, providing a robust alternative to deterministic methods.

The book begins with an intuitive explanation of probability theory, emphasizing Bayes' theorem. From there, it introduces the concept of a "Probabilistic Program," which combines statistical formalism with powerful computational tools. By exploring various distributions, dependencies, and Bayesian inference mechanisms, readers learn to approach complex systems in a structured and repeatable manner.

Furthermore, the authors guide readers through interpreting observed data, modeling probabilistic systems, and designing adaptive agents capable of operating in real-world scenarios. With practical examples and case studies, the book highlights applications in fields like robotics (autonomous navigation), human-computer interaction, and cognitive modeling.

"Bayesian Programming" doesn't just provide theory—it emphasizes the practical utility of Bayesian methods across disciplines. Readers are introduced to the implementation of probabilistic programming languages and learn best practices for crafting their own Bayesian models.

Key Takeaways from "Bayesian Programming"

This book is a treasure trove of insights for anyone interested in artificial intelligence, probability theory, or decision-making systems. Here are some of the key takeaways:

  • Understand the fundamentals of Bayesian reasoning and its applications in uncertain systems.
  • Learn the syntax and semantics of probabilistic programming languages.
  • Design adaptable and robust systems that function effectively amidst uncertainty.
  • Explore diverse real-world applications, from robotics to predictive analytics.
  • Master the art of balancing prior knowledge with observed evidence to refine models.

Famous Quotes from "Bayesian Programming"

Throughout the book, the authors present powerful statements that encapsulate the essence of Bayesian reasoning. Here are a few extracts:

"Uncertainty is not an obstacle but a fundamental component of intelligence, and Bayesian reasoning is its most elegant guide."

"The secret to adaptive, intelligent systems lies in the fusion of evidence and probability."

"Bayesian Programming bridges the gap between mathematical theory and practical decision-making."

"In a probabilistic world, flexibility and reasoning flourish where deterministic methods fall short."

Why "Bayesian Programming" Matters

In a world increasingly driven by data, uncertainty is ubiquitous. Traditional deterministic algorithms often falter when faced with incomplete or ambiguous inputs. This is where Bayesian methods stand out, offering a principled approach to handle uncertainty and make informed predictions.

Moreover, Bayesian inference provides the backbone for advanced fields like deep learning, autonomous navigation, computer vision, and natural language processing. Understanding these principles is critical for anyone looking to contribute meaningfully to such areas. The book not only equips readers with theoretical tools but also empowers them with actionable insights and practical techniques.

As industries continue to adopt more probabilistic approaches, the concepts explored in "Bayesian Programming" are becoming increasingly important. This book matters because it democratizes access to these ideas, making them understandable to readers of diverse backgrounds and experience levels. It's not just a textbook, but a roadmap for navigating an uncertain world with confidence and precision.

دانلود رایگان مستقیم

You Can Download this book after Login

دسترسی به کتاب‌ها از طریق پلتفرم‌های قانونی و کتابخانه‌های عمومی نه تنها از حقوق نویسندگان و ناشران حمایت می‌کند، بلکه به پایداری فرهنگ کتابخوانی نیز کمک می‌رساند. پیش از دانلود، لحظه‌ای به بررسی این گزینه‌ها فکر کنید.

این کتاب رو در پلتفرم های دیگه ببینید

WorldCat به شما کمک میکنه تا کتاب ها رو در کتابخانه های سراسر دنیا پیدا کنید
امتیازها، نظرات تخصصی و صحبت ها درباره کتاب را در Goodreads ببینید
کتاب‌های کمیاب یا دست دوم را در AbeBooks پیدا کنید و بخرید

نویسندگان:


نظرات:


4.3

بر اساس 0 نظر کاربران